The Cardinals had lost five of six heading into Saturday’s game, but they got a big 4-0 win and then followed it up with a 15-6 win on Sunday.
Sunday’s game ended with Albert Pujols taking the mound for the first time in his career. He did give up four runs, but he got the three outs and the Cardinals went home with their second straight win.
Monday they will look to get another win against a Mets team that is in first place in the NL East.
The Mets have a comfortable 5.5-game lead on the Phillies right now, but they have lost three of their last five and are coming off a series loss to the Mariners.
It has been a bit of a tough stretch for them, but they still sit at 23-13 on the season and have played well overall.
Monday they send Trevor Williams to the mound looking to bounce back from their loss on Sunday. Williams is 0-2 on the year with a 5.73 ERA. The Mets have won just one of his five starts this year.
